I can't remember how to change the settings (until I read the Linux Journal
article), but if you type "about:config" in the browser, it will bring up the
current configurations for your browser. This window is where you can modify,
delete, or add Preferences. Right clicking on a setting will bring up some
options for modifying a Preference.
